Установка Node.js: Основа для React-разработки - React для новичков: От Азов до Первых Компонентов - Qpel.AI

Установка Node.js: Основа для React-разработки

Мы уже знаем, что React помогает нам строить интерфейсы из «кубиков» — компонентов. Но чтобы эти «кубики» ожили и превратились в работающее приложение, нужна специальная среда. Представьте, что вы хотите построить дом из LEGO, но у вас нет стола, на котором можно собирать детали, и инструкции. Так и с React — ему нужна основа, на которой он будет работать.

Зачем нужен Node.js?

React-приложения используют современный JavaScript. Браузеры не всегда понимают все его возможности. К тому же, чтобы собрать проект, установить библиотеки (те самые «кубики» от других разработчиков), нужен специальный инструмент. Это и есть Node.js.

Node.js — это не язык программирования, а среда выполнения JavaScript. Она позволяет запускать JavaScript-код не только в браузере, но и на вашем компьютере. Это как универсальный переводчик и организатор для нашего кода.

Вместе с Node.js устанавливается npm (Node Package Manager) — менеджер пакетов. Думайте о нём как о большом магазине, где хранятся миллионы готовых «кубиков» (библиотек и инструментов). Их создали и выложили в общий доступ другие разработчики. С помощью npm мы легко добавим в проект нужные инструменты, включая сам React.

Установка Node.js: Пошаговая инструкция

Установить Node.js очень просто. Следуйте этим шагам:

  1. Перейдите на официальный сайт Node.js: https://nodejs.org/ru/

  2. Выберите версию для загрузки: Вы увидите две основные версии:

    • LTS (рекомендуется): Это Long Term Support — версия с долгосрочной поддержкой. Она самая стабильная и проверенная, идеально подходит для начала работы. 👍
    • Текущая: Содержит новые функции, но может быть менее стабильной. Для новичков лучше выбрать LTS.
  3. Скачайте установщик: Нажмите на кнопку "LTS" (например, "18.19.0 LTS") и скачайте файл для вашей операционной системы (Windows, macOS, Linux).

  4. Запустите установщик: Откройте скачанный файл и следуйте инструкциям. Обычно достаточно нажимать "Далее" (Next) и соглашаться с лицензионным соглашением. Убедитесь, что выбрана установка npm (она обычно включена по умолчанию).

  5. Проверьте установку: После завершения установки откройте терминал (командную строку).

    • Windows: Нажмите Win + R, введите cmd и нажмите Enter.
    • macOS: Откройте "Программы" -> "Утилиты" -> "Терминал".
    • Linux: Обычно доступен через Ctrl + Alt + T.

    В терминале введите команды и нажмите Enter после каждой:

    node -v
    npm -v
    

    Если вы увидите номера версий Node.js и npm (например, v18.19.0 и 10.2.4), значит, установка прошла успешно! 🎉

Важно: Если вы используете Windows, убедитесь, что у вас есть права администратора для установки программ. Если возникнут проблемы, попробуйте запустить установщик от имени администратора.

Теперь, когда у нас есть Node.js и npm, мы готовы к следующему шагу — созданию нашего первого React-проекта! В следующем разделе мы узнаем, как быстро «собрать» основу для нашего приложения с помощью Vite.